Plot Summary

This documentary follows the journey of Gasolin United, a Vietnamese youth football team, as they compete in the prestigious Gothia Cup in Sweden. It showcases their dreams, struggles, and the spirit of camaraderie they share both on and off the field. The film highlights the cultural exchange and the universal language of sport.

Fun Fact

The Gothia Cup, where Gasolin United competes, is one of the world's largest international youth football tournaments, attracting teams from over 70 nations.
